Score:0

การจัดการ URL ที่ยาวในการเปลี่ยนเส้นทาง 302 บน nginx

ธง cn

ฉันมีเครื่องมือย่อ URL ที่ทำงานบน nginx (1.20.0) ซึ่งเปลี่ยนเส้นทางไปยัง URL ต่างๆ โดยใช้การเปลี่ยนเส้นทาง 302 อย่างง่าย (Django เปลี่ยนเส้นทาง ทางลัดเพื่อความแม่นยำซึ่งส่ง 302) ฉันสังเกตเห็นว่าด้วย URL เฉพาะ (รวมมากกว่า 3850 ไบต์) nginx ปฏิเสธที่จะส่ง 302 และส่งกลับข้อผิดพลาด 502 แทน

ดูเหมือนว่านี่เป็นปัญหาการกำหนดค่าเซิร์ฟเวอร์ ฉันจะปรับขนาดสูงสุดของ 302 ได้ที่ไหน

Ivan Shatsky avatar
gr flag
การปรับการบัฟเฟอร์พร็อกซีบางครั้งสามารถช่วยแก้ปัญหาดังกล่าวได้ ตรวจสอบคำสั่ง `proxy_buffers`, `proxy_buffer_size`, `proxy_busy_buffers_size` สิ่งเหล่านี้มีไว้สำหรับโมดูลพร็อกซี HTTP แต่ยังมีอะนาล็อกสำหรับโมดูล FastCGI (`fastcgi_*`) หรือ uWSGI (`uwsgi_*`)

โพสต์คำตอบ

คนส่วนใหญ่ไม่เข้าใจว่าการถามคำถามมากมายจะปลดล็อกการเรียนรู้และปรับปรุงความสัมพันธ์ระหว่างบุคคล ตัวอย่างเช่น ในการศึกษาของ Alison แม้ว่าผู้คนจะจำได้อย่างแม่นยำว่ามีคำถามกี่ข้อที่ถูกถามในการสนทนา แต่พวกเขาไม่เข้าใจความเชื่อมโยงระหว่างคำถามและความชอบ จากการศึกษาทั้ง 4 เรื่องที่ผู้เข้าร่วมมีส่วนร่วมในการสนทนาด้วยตนเองหรืออ่านบันทึกการสนทนาของผู้อื่น ผู้คนมักไม่ตระหนักว่าการถามคำถามจะมีอิทธิพลหรือมีอิทธิพลต่อระดับมิตรภาพระหว่างผู้สนทนา